Understanding Off-Grid Solar Systems
Off-grid solar systems are designed to operate independently of the utility grid. They consist of solar panels, batteries, charge controllers, and inverters, enabling users to generate, store, and utilize solar energy. This setup is particularly beneficial for remote areas where grid access is limited or unreliable.
Technical Features of Off-Grid Solar Systems
The following table summarizes the key technical features of off-grid solar systems:
Feature | Description |
---|---|
Solar Panels | Convert sunlight into electricity; available in monocrystalline and polycrystalline types. |
Batteries | Store excess energy for use during non-sunny periods; options include lithium-ion, AGM, and gel batteries. |
Charge Controller | Regulates the voltage and current from the solar panels to prevent battery overcharging. |
Inverter | Converts DC electricity from the solar panels and batteries into AC electricity for household use. |
System Size | Varies from small kits (200W) for homes to larger systems (up to 100kW) for commercial use. |
Durability | Designed to withstand harsh weather conditions, ensuring longevity and reliability. |
Types of Off-Grid Solar Systems
Off-grid solar systems can be categorized based on their configuration and application. The following table outlines the different types:
Type | Description |
---|---|
Standalone Systems | Completely independent systems that do not connect to the grid; ideal for remote locations. |
Hybrid Systems | Combine off-grid and grid-tied features, allowing for backup power from the grid when needed. |
Mobile Systems | Portable setups designed for RVs, boats, or camping; easy to transport and install. |
Commercial Systems | Larger systems designed for businesses or industrial applications, providing significant power output. |
Residential Systems | Tailored for home use, these systems can power appliances and lighting efficiently. |

FAQs
1. What is an off-grid solar system?
An off-grid solar system generates electricity independently from the utility grid, using solar panels, batteries, and inverters to provide power for homes or businesses.
2. How long do off-grid solar systems last?
With proper maintenance, off-grid solar systems can last 25 years or more, although individual components like batteries may need replacement every 5 to 10 years.
